C++ Debug 模式下程序崩溃: Expression: is_block_type_valid(header->block_use)

出现这样的错误,可能有很多种原因,而我出现崩溃的原因是由于代码中定义了vector容器, 未对它进行初始化操作导致的, 只要对它的大小进行初始化操作就行了

崩溃代码:

   vector<Rect> faces

正常代码:

  vector<Rect> faces;
  faces.reserve(10);

posted @ 2018-11-14 17:14  Software_hul  阅读(3789)  评论(1编辑  收藏  举报